George and Margaret Wealthy are in the 42 percent tax bracket, considering both federal and state personal taxes. Norman Briggs, then CEO of Community General Hospital, has been aggressively pursuing the couple to contribute $400 thousand to the hospital’s soon-to-be-built Cancer Care Center. Without the contribution, the Wealth’s taxable income for 2014 would be $3 million. What impact would the contribution have on the Wealth’s 2014 tax bill?
